Architectural Integrity and Original Design

Studying the architectural integrity of the Clint House reveals deliberate strategies to frame views, control sunlight, and connect interior spaces with the landscape. Large horizontal windows, deep overhangs, and a low profile respond to the local climate while expressing a restrained Modernist vocabulary.

Preservation guidelines emphasize retaining signature elements such as flush wood panels, concealed lighting coves, and engineered roof planes. Any replacement components must match the original profile, fastening pattern, and material scale to maintain the structure’s visual continuity.

Site Planning and Landscape Integration

The site planning of the Clint House organizes circulation, outdoor living, and vehicle access around a central concrete courtyard. Landscape integration relies on native plantings, decomposed granite paths, and a shallow reflecting pool that echoes the horizontal lines of the architecture.

Stormwater management combines permeable paving, concealed underdrains, and carefully graded planting beds to direct runoff toward bioswales. This approach reduces peak flows, supports root health, and complies with municipal erosion control regulations.

Modern Renovations and Performance Upgrades

Contemporary renovations to the Clint House prioritize thermal comfort, airtightness, and resilience while respecting the original aesthetic sequence of spaces. Performance upgrades include advanced insulation behind original masonry, high efficiency glazing, and discretely placed mechanical equipment.

Commissioning protocols verify that upgraded systems operate quietly, maintain setpoint control, and provide balanced ventilation. Detailed commissioning reports provide owners with baseline metrics, recommended fine tuning, and guidance for future maintenance cycles.

How does the original concrete structure of the Clint House affect ongoing maintenance?

Regular inspection of joints, control joints, and surface sealers prevents moisture intrusion, while gentle cleaning methods protect the aggregate finish and avoid premature spalling.

What are typical costs for upgrading windows while preserving the appearance of the Clint House?

Custom wood clad units or high performance aluminum clad options can replicate original sightlines and proportions, with costs varying by grid size, glazing performance, and installation complexity.

Can the design of the Clint House accommodate modern accessibility without altering its historic character?

Strategic interventions such as platform lifts, redesigned entry thresholds, and reconfigured interior circulation can improve access while minimizing visible alteration to significant fabric.

What incentives are available for owners maintaining a property of this architectural significance?

Tax credits, heritage conservation grants, and favorable loan programs may be available when work is undertaken in accordance with approved preservation plans and engineering standards.
